Text Effect Do Not Work If Not On The Last Frame.
Hi,
I have a problem in using the Text effect. Here's my problem:
1. I add the Text and Text effect in the first frame. It works.
2. However when I add a second blank frame. The text animation does not work. Actually the situation is the same whenever the text effect is not on the last frame.
Please help.

I believe the effect happens over key frame duration.
In other words, the text is on the first frame and not on the next.
So, there is no text for the effect to apply to.
Make certain that your text is up as long
as the effect duration takes place.
